Burnt flowers
by Nadine Monfils

previous next


In a small Parisian room‚ Marie–Madeleine tries hard to forget her mother‚ the marquise of Brinvilliers‚ the famous wicked woman… until the day she starts receiving mysterious packages (dead rats‚ a cut hand‚ etc.) which remind her of the terrible crimes of the person who brought her to the world. Hiding in the Paris of the seventeenth century‚ the city of the homeless‚ prostitutes‚ and beggars‚ and followed by this creepy package carrier‚ the young girl meets a well–meaning stranger. With his help‚ Marie–Madeleine starts to hunt down her mother’s past. Age: 15 and up
